Wearable 4th of July Makeup Looks

June 18, 2020 By Karen Lang

The coming of July 4 always brings in inspiration to so many artists here in America. In particular, 4th of July makeup looks are a hot trend right around this time and you’re probably wondering what makeup look to wear to celebrate Independence Day.

Nationalistic pride and makeup artistry have always gone hand in hand throughout history. This year, even in the middle of all the noise, one thing brings us all together. The land of the free and home of the brave.

Let us celebrate the best about Independence Day with these makeup looks you can cop on your own.

Best 4th of July Makeup Inspiration

1. Navy Drop Shadow

|

The first 4th of July makeup look is by Kathleen Lights, using bright red lipstick and keeping the eye festive with a navy blue eyeshadow lining the lower lid paired with a bold wing liner and a swipe of white eyeshadow on the eyelid.

2. Vampy and Bold 4th of July Makeup

|

This is one of my favorite 4th of July makeup looks because it’s different and sexy. Using a midnight blue shade shadow swept across the lids brought to a V on the outer corner, and deep red lips contoured with black eyeshadow is refreshingly dark.

3. Double Liner

|

Create a double-wing liner using black and white eyeliner and create a shadow on your lower lid with blue eyeshadow. Paired with a red lipstick this look is a youthful take on Independence Day makeup.

4. Glitter and Blue Liner

|

Nikkietutorials also serves up one of the prettiest 4th of July makeup looks for us by using glitter under the eye and a navy blue eyeliner to keep the look interesting.

5. Go Pin-Up 4th of July Makeup

|

Although this is more of an era look, this pin-up makeup look by Shaaanxo is simple and chic to wear outside on any given day. While it wasn’t really created as a 4th of July makeup look, it still very much looks the part.

Using glossy red lip color and creating an ombre eyeliner that starts from silver at the inner corner, going blue, to black on the wingtip. Very chic and very apt for Independence Day.

6. Notes from Harley Quinn

|

I’ve always thought Harley Quinn’s makeup has a patriotic nod to it and turning it into a fourth of July makeup inspiration is not a bad idea at all. Create a vibe of rebel chic by using blue eyeshadow on one eye, and red on the other.

RELATED: 20 Fun 4th Of July Nail Designs To Show Your Love For America

7. Star-Spangled

[instagram url=https://www.instagram.com/p/BzhXRULh8UJ/ hidecaption=true width=800]

Keep it warm and low-key with a deeper blue eyeshadow and red berry lips. Don’t forget the stars, in glitter, of course. It creates a beautiful light-reflecting effect to the entire look.

8. Glitter Trails 4th of July Makeup

[instagram url=https://www.instagram.com/p/CA_QCCepdpK/ hidecaption=true width=800]

Let the glitters speak for themselves. A clean and simple makeup look is always easier to do, but using glitters to bring the message across is pretty neat. Make sure to only use star-shaped glitters in red, blue, and white.

9. Cut Crease

@angsty_baeRED WHITE & BLUE makeup look ❤️🥼💙 ##makeup ##4thofjuly ##firework ##makeupchallenge ##makeuptutorial♬ Firework – Katy Perry


Glam up with the colors of the American flag by using a white eyeliner to deepen the cut crease on your fourth of July makeup look. Let’s put special attention to Maja’s use of red eyeliner to create a dramatic eye look without sacrificing the theme.

10. Red Mascara

[instagram url=https://www.instagram.com/p/B0JnHCiJ_H3/ hidecaption=true width=800]

An otherwise simple makeup look by using blue eyeshadow as details on the eye look but creating dramatic peepers by using red pigment on the lashes. The subtle hint of red on the eyes pairs beautifully with the bright red lipstick used on this look by Meg Benitez.

11. Freckle Star 4th of July Makeup

|

Wear the star-spangled banner all across your face by creating white freckles. Keep in theme with the fourth of July makeup look by incorporating red and blue on your eye makeup.

12. Bright Blue and Red

[instagram url=https://www.instagram.com/p/Bi616eDgW19/ hidecaption=true width=800]
Create a statement by wearing a blue lipstick paired with blue, red, and white eye makeup look. The higher the saturation, the better.

13. Flag Details

|

Create exquisitely clean details on your eyes using the colors and the symbols of the American flag to celebrate Independence Day.

Minnie Mcgee has beautifully played her fourth of July makeup look with a detailed eyeshadow work using blue and red eyeshadows, white eyeliner, and star glitter stick on. Something you can do too.
